Abstract

The utility model provides an optical module of an LED (light-emitting diode) lamp. The optical module comprises an LED light source, a reflector and a light distributing lens, wherein the reflector is positioned above the LED light source; and the light distributing lens is installed above the reflector. The optical module of the LED lamp provided by the utility model can treat light rays emitted from the LED light source in a full-angle range and has the advantages that the light type view angle effect is good, the light-emitting efficiency is high, the weight is light, and the volume is small.

Description

A kind of LED light fixture optics module
Technical field
The utility model belongs to field of illuminating lamps, relates in particular to a kind of LED light fixture optics module.
Background technology
Existing LED light fixture adopts reflector or lens to carry out the light shaping usually; For the LED light fixture that adopts reflector to carry out the light shaping; Because reflector can only carry out shaping to the LED high angle scattered light, can not carry out shaping to LED low-angle light, causes the light shaping effect bad; For the LED light fixture that adopts lens to carry out the light shaping, because lens can not be too thin, thin lens light extraction efficiency is low, and lens are too thick can to cause consumptive material, volume, weight big again, is difficult for problems such as installation.
The utility model content
The purpose of the utility model provides a kind of LED light fixture optics module, can carry out the full angle scope to the light that the light fixture led light source sends and handle, and reaches the effect that light type view effect is good, light extraction efficiency is high.
For achieving the above object, the utility model is to adopt following technical scheme to realize:
The utility model provides a kind of LED light fixture optics module, comprises led light source, reflection shield, light-distribution lens; Said reflection shield is positioned at the led light source top, and said light-distribution lens is installed in the top of reflection shield.
Said light-distribution lens can be following thrin: the surface is the Fresnel lens of pearl face for Fresnel lens, the surface of light face or erosion line face for the Fresnel lens of cornice plane, surface.
The central area of said light-distribution lens is the Fresnel face, and the Fresnel face can also can also can exist at the inner surface and the outer surface of lens at the inner surface of lens in lens outer surface simultaneously.
Said light-distribution lens inner surface also can be made up of the annular prism.
Preferably, said reflection shield adopts high reflective white plastic material, but single injection-molded is processed.
The operation principle of the LED light fixture optics module that the utility model provides is following: the light that led light source sends sends through the light-distribution lens integer, the refraction that place the place ahead, and illumination is provided; Part reflexes to light-distribution lens again, penetrates through after the secondary reshaping, in order to illumination to be provided through the reflection shield that is installed in the light-distribution lens below through the light without shaping of said light-distribution lens reflection.
The advantage of the utility model is:
The LED light fixture optics module that the utility model provides, the light that adopts reflection shield and light-distribution lens that led light source is sent carry out multiple luminous intensity distribution, shaping is handled, and light type view effect is good, light extraction efficiency is high; Adopt Fresnel lens as light-distribution lens, can make light fixture do thinlyyer, thus the volume and weight of economical with materials, minimizing light fixture; Better, reflection shield adopts high reflective white plastic material, but single injection-molded is processed the reduction manufacturing cost.

The specific embodiment
For the purpose, technical scheme and the advantage that make the utility model is clearer,, the utility model is further elaborated below in conjunction with accompanying drawing.
Like Fig. 1, the LED light fixture optics module that the utility model provides comprises led light source 1, reflection shield 2, light-distribution lens 3; Reflection shield 2 is installed in led light source 1 top, and light-distribution lens 3 is installed in the top of reflection shield 2; The light that led light source 1 sends is handled the back and is penetrated through luminous intensity distribution, the shaping of reflection shield 2 and light-distribution lens 3, and illumination uniformity is good, light extraction efficiency is high, light type view effect is good.
Like Fig. 3,4, embodiment 1, and light-distribution lens 3 is surface Fresnel lenses 6 for light face or erosion line face.
Like Fig. 5,6, embodiment 2, and light-distribution lens 3 is that the surface is the Fresnel lens 7 of cornice plane.
Like Fig. 7,8, embodiment 3, and light-distribution lens 3 is that the surface is the Fresnel lens 8 of pearl face face.
Like Fig. 9,10, embodiment 4, and the central area inner surface 10 and the outer surface 9 of light-distribution lens 3 are the Fresnel face, and non-central zone is an annular prism 11.
Like Fig. 2, prior art LED light fixture optics module does not have light-distribution lens 3, and the light core that led light source sends directly penetrates; Core light 4 can't obtain luminous intensity distribution and handle; Reflecting surface reflection ray 5 dispersion angles are big, and the projection light type is bad, and the irradiation of light is inhomogeneous.
Comparison diagram 1 and Fig. 2; Rising angle, the illumination uniformity that can reflect the LED light fixture optics module that the utility model provides obviously are better than prior art high-power LED lamp optics module; The LED light fixture optics module that the utility model provides can carry out the full angle scope to the light that the light fixture led light source sends to be handled, and light type view effect is good, light extraction efficiency is high, illumination uniformity good.Better, reflection shield adopts high reflective white plastic material, but single injection-molded is processed.
